That totally depends on where you are buying it, and also somewhat on who you are buying it from. Prices for land are higher and lower in different states (and in different countries), and vary within states a lot as well. In general, land in a more desirable or popular neighborhood will cost you a lot more money than if you are buying undeveloped land far from any town or city.

The Homestead Act of 1862 provided settlers with 160 acres of land if they agreed to live on and improve the land for five years. This act aimed to encourage westward expansion and settlement of the frontier in the United States.
